home *** CD-ROM | disk | FTP | other *** search
/ Interplay's Learn to Program Basic (Review Copy) / Learn to Program Basic Review Copy (Interplay)(June 23, 1998).ISO / pc / ltpbasic / projects / dragon.bas < prev    next >
BASIC Source File  |  1998-04-08  |  657b  |  49 lines

  1. Cls
  2.  
  3. dragonX = 50
  4. dragonY = 50
  5.  
  6. dragon = LoadSprite("DrgnSmlR")
  7.  
  8. SetSprite dragon To 50,50
  9. CycleSprite dragon
  10.  
  11. Background "SPACE199"
  12.  
  13. RunGame = 1
  14.  
  15. While RunGame
  16. If KeyDown("CURUP") Then
  17. dragonY = dragonY - 1
  18. EndIf
  19.  
  20. If KeyDown("CURRIGHT") Then
  21. SetSprite dragon Flipped
  22. dragonX = dragonX + 1
  23. EndIf
  24.  
  25. If KeyDown("CURDOWN") Then
  26. dragonY = dragonY + 1
  27. EndIf
  28.  
  29. If KeyDown("CURLEFT") THEN
  30. SetSprite dragon Normal
  31. dragonX = dragonX - 1
  32. EndIf
  33.  
  34. If dragonX < 0 Then dragonX = 0
  35. If dragonX > 300 Then dragonX = 300
  36.  
  37. If dragonY < 0 Then dragonY = 0
  38. If dragonY > 220 Then dragonY = 220
  39.  
  40. SetSprite dragon To dragonX, dragonY
  41.  
  42. If KeyDown("Q") THEN
  43. RunGame = 0
  44. EndIf
  45.  
  46. Wend
  47.  
  48.